  • Patent number: 6664330
    Abstract: An emulsion of a monomer having a radical polymerizable unsaturated bond, which is obtained by emulsifying the monomer in the presence of an emulsifier, and a mixed solution of a specific non-radical polymerizable organosilicon compound and a polymerization initiator, which is soluble in the non-radical polymerizable organosilicon compound, are added to an aqueous medium, followed by emulsion polymerization, hydrolysis, and condensation, to produce a waterborne resin emulsion and a waterborne coating which can form a coating film having superior durability such as water resistance, weathering resistance, or the like.

  • Patent number: 6482890
    Abstract: An object is to remarkably improve the water resistance and weather resistance of the cured coating film in the aqueous curable resin composition. An aqueous dispersion is used as a main agent which contains, as essential components, gel-like resin dispersed particles having a functional group selected from a salt of a tertiary amino group or a salt of an acid group and an aqueous medium, and a compound having both an epoxy group and a hydrolyzable silyl group is used as a curing agent.

  • Patent number: 6005029
    Abstract: The present invention comprises an improved organic composite-plated steel plate which is obtained by applying a thermosetting resin to a chromate-coated alloy-plated steel plate and curing this, wherein, various aqueous resin compositions having the form of basic coating film formation components, such as, for example, aqueous vinyl modified epoxy ester resins, or aqueous vinyl modified epoxy ester resin / blocked isocyanate compound-types, or aqueous vinyl modified epoxy ester resin / blocked isocyanate compounds / colloidal silica-types, are used as the thermosetting resin described above.

  • Patent number: 5616645
    Abstract: The present invention relates to a gelled fluoride resin fine particle dispersion for use as a coating, to a method of production thereof, and to a method using this gelled fluoride resin fine dispersion to protect an alkaline inorganic hardened body.The objective of the present invention is to provide an aqueous resin for use as a coating, this aqueous resin being able to form a high performance coating film that is superior in its ability to inhibit the leaching out of the alkaline substance from the alkaline inorganic hardened body, which has excellent weatherability, water resistance, alkaline resistance, and dirt picking resistance.The present invention accomplishes the stated objective through the utilization of gelled fine particles of a fluorine containing resin.The present invention may be used in the coating field.
